Objective / Purpose:

The Research Scientific Director Head of Small molecule Automation is based in Cambridge MA within the R&D Research division specifically supporting Takedas Digital Discovery & Development Engine. This full-time Director-level role is instrumental in building and leading the automation of small molecule synthesis for Takedas Lab of the Future initiative to implement highly efficient AI-integrated DMTA (DesignMakeTestAnalyze) cycles toward rapid and reliable small molecule discovery.

The Head of Small Molecule Automation leads the strategy design and execution of small molecule synthesis using fully automated robotic platforms to accelerate decision-making across Takedas discovery portfolio by quickly and reliably generating compound sets for testing. The role collaborates closely with medicinal chemistry in-vitro pharmacology DMPK data science/AI/computational chemistry and automation engineering to ensure seamless integration of compound synthesis with AI-driven design and includes integrating retrosynthetic planning route design and advanced chemical reaction miniaturization capabilities.

Accountabilities:

  • Define and execute the automation strategy for small-molecule synthesis aligning platform capabilities with organizational discovery and development goals and the Lab of the Future roadmap.
    • Prioritize and sequence automation investments in equipment software and talent based on scientific impact throughput gains and cost-to-value ratios.
    • Promote the adoption of digital-first and automated approaches across the research community as a change champion.
  • Establish a closed-loop DMTA vision by integrating robotics digital data capture and AI/ML to boost synthesis throughput reduce cycle times and enhance decision quality.
    • Design end-to-end automated workflows for reaction scouting parallel synthesis scale-out and purification (e.g. flash/Prep-HPLC) to ensure reproducibility and traceability.
    • Standardize method libraries and digital SOPs covering reaction templates purification methods and analytical routines to enable rapid and consistent deployment across programs.
    • Continuously evaluate and integrate new technologies such as liquid-handling robotics continuous flow microreactors smart reactors and generative chemistry tools.
    • Accelerate DMTA cycles through high-throughput experimentation (HTE) parallel synthesis arrays flow chemistry and automated purification integrated with ELN/LIMS and scheduling/orchestration systems for efficient low-touch labs.
    • Establish and refine a vision for fully integrated workflows that encompass compound design purification QC data capture analysis and sample preparation for testing.
    • Define track and report KPIs such as workflow efficiency data accessibility and cycle time improvements.
    • Encourage method innovation including novel reaction classes on automation greener conditions and continuous processing.
  • Drive reliability engineering preventive maintenance and improvements
    • Integrate EHS machine safety and cybersecurity
    • Ensure up-time with scheduled maintenance spares management incident handling and corrective action.
    • Scale workflows from prototype to routine and maintain lab safety and compliance for automated operations.
    • Oversee change control validation risk assessment and conduct drills and post-mortems.
  • Engage externally through contributions to patents publications and presentations that highlight platform advancements and by active participation in consortia and conferences to share knowledge and gain insights to remain at the forefront of best practices.
  • Contribute to data governance practices that promote longitudinal learning across Takedas discovery portfolio.

Education & Competencies (Technical and Behavioral):

  • Expected: Ph.D. in Organic or Medicinal Chemistry (or related field) with 10 years of experience; or M.S. with 16 years of experience; or B.S. with 18 years of experience in pharmaceutical or biotech R&D including small-molecule discovery.
  • Deep medicinal chemistry knowledge including SAR SBDD cheminformatics and ADME/PK data interpretation.
  • 10 years building and scaling lab or chemical process automation and 5 years leading cross-functional R&D teams.
  • Proficiency with automated synthesis platforms including robotic reaction screening parallel synthesis and purification systems.
  • Experience with AI-driven DMTA and autonomous design-make loops and experiment planners.
  • Familiarity with scheduling software LIMS/ELN and data pipeline tools used in automated labs.
  • Strong leadership managing and developing scientific teams at the senior scientist/principal scientist level.
  • Exceptional written and verbal communication with ability to influence at the Executive Director and VP levels.
  • Demonstrated ability to drive change and transformation in complex global R&D organizations.
